At 40 years old, Josh Hawley is the youngest US Senator, coming out of Missouri

He is the son of a banker, received a private prep school education, got his Bachelor's from Stanford and graduated from Yale Law.
He provided legal counsel for the Becket Fund for Religious Liberty where he worked on the Supreme Court cases of Hosanna Tabor v. EEOC and Burwell v. Hobby Lobby.

https://www.oyez.org/cases/2011/10-553
You might remember the Hobby Lobby decision. The Court ruled that for-profit entities could deny their employee's health insurance that provides contraception on the basis of religious freedom
